What are the key components found in Expo whiteboard marker inks?

Expo whiteboard marker inks typically consist of a blend of solvents, pigments, and binders. The exact composition varies depending on the specific marker type (e.g., dry-erase, wet-erase). However, common components often include alcohols, glycol ethers, and various resins. Detailed ingredient lists are found in the individual SDS for each marker product. It's essential to consult the specific SDS for the marker you're using to understand its unique composition. This information is crucial for determining potential health hazards and choosing appropriate safety measures.

What are the potential health hazards associated with Expo whiteboard markers?

The primary hazards associated with Expo whiteboard markers typically stem from inhalation of the vapors and potential skin contact. Solvents in the ink can cause respiratory irritation, dizziness, headaches, and in some cases, more severe health effects with prolonged or high-level exposure. Skin contact can lead to irritation or allergic reactions in sensitive individuals. Ingestion is unlikely but should be avoided; the SDS will specify the necessary actions in the event of accidental ingestion.

Are Expo whiteboard markers flammable?

Many Expo whiteboard markers contain flammable solvents. The SDS will clearly indicate the flammability characteristics of the product, including its flash point. This information is crucial for storing and handling the markers safely, ensuring they are kept away from ignition sources and in a well-ventilated area.

Where can I find the SDS for Expo whiteboard markers?

The SDS for Expo whiteboard markers is usually accessible through the manufacturer's website (typically Newell Brands). You may need to search by product name or number to find the relevant SDS. Alternatively, contacting customer support may be necessary to obtain the SDS directly. It's always best to have the product's specific identification information (such as the product number or lot number) on hand.
